To help identify if your home is losing heat, Gunnislake Community Matters (GCM) has an easy to use Thermal Imaging Camera that is available to all residents of Calstock Parish villages to borrow. The camera has been bought by GCM with a Cornwall Council Community Chest Grant, made available to us by Cllr Dorothy Kirk.
The camera captures heat images using colours to show hot, warm and cold spots. The idea behind the purchase of the camera is for residents to use it in their homes to look for cold spots, and having found them, research if there is anything that can be done to reduce those spots, by, for example, increasing insulation or stopping draughts.
Hopefully reducing the cold spots will result in lower heating bills for people and will lead to some environmental benefits.
